12volt lights dim with 120v load cycles

We just got a new Insta-pot pressure cooker/crock pot and when it cycles on the 12v lights dim. It made me wonder why a 120 volt load would change the brightness of a 12 volt light when it would have to go through a converter and battery to do so.

2018 Forest River 40CCK
Single 12 volt battery
WFCO WF-9855 Converter
Insta-pot is 1000 watts

Depending on what else is running of 120VAC, you can get a voltage drop on the 120VAC line which can impact the converter output. This can reduce the converter output and result in a change in the 12V light brightness.
